Session Summary
April 14, 2003
This Support WebCast session will discuss what the three types of replication are, when to implement them, and how they work on Microsoft SQL Server. The WebCast will also discuss other alternatives that you can use for replication.
This is a Level 200 session that was presented by Hina Masud. Hina Masud has been with Microsoft for four years and has supported SQL replication beginning with SQL Server version 6.5. She is an MCSE and MCDBA. Hina currently works for PSS, has written articles, and has delivered internal presentations about the topic.
